Compound 'A' was prepared by oxidation of compound 'B' with alkaline MnO4. Compound 'A' on reduction with lithium aluminium hydride gets converted back to compound 'B'. When compound 'A' is heated with compound 'B' in the presence of H2SO4 it produces fruity smell of compound 'C' to which family the compounds 'A', 'B' and 'C' belong to?

Explanation:
Thus, compound 'A' belongs to the carboxylic acid as alkaline KMnO4 is a strong oxidizing agent. Compound 'A' on reduction with lithium aluminium hydride gets converted back to compound 'B'. Thus, compound 'B' belongs to an alcohol as lithium aluminium hydride is a strong reducing agent.
